Description
A delightful chicken dish featuring savory garlic and fresh herbs, per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
- 4 boneless skinless chicken breasts
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
- 1 tablespoon fresh thyme leaves
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 1 cup chicken broth
- 2 pounds russet potatoes
- ½ cup heavy cream
- 2 tablespoons br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on balsamic vinegar
Instructions
- Pat the chicken breasts dry and season with salt and pepper. Rub the garlic-herb mixture onto the chicken and let rest for 10 minutes.
- Heat olive oil in a skillet and sear the chicken for 5-6 minutes on each side until golden-brown. Baste with butter and pan juices.
- Make the sauce by adding brown sugar and balsamic vinegar to the drippings, then adding chicken broth and reducing.
- Prepare mashed potatoes by boiling them until fork-tender, then mashing with butter and cream.
- Plate the dish with mashed potatoes and chicken, drizzling with the sauce and garnishing with herbs.
Notes
For extra flavor, consider marinating the chicken for a few hours before cooking. Serve with seasonal vegetables for a complete meal.
